SJU Softball Swept by Notre Dame
4/29/2000 12:00:00 AM | Softball
The first game was scoreless through three innings, until the Irish scored three runs, including two on a home run by sophomore catcher Jarrah Myers. St. John's answered back in the bottom of the inning with an unearned run with two outs to close the gap to 3-1.
The score remained the same until the top of the seventh, when Irish junior Melanie Alkire led-off the inning with a solo home run. Myers and junior Danielle Klayman then each added RBI singles to score three more runs as the Irish took a 7-1 lead.
In the bottom of the seventh inning, St. John's scored a run on a RBI single by freshman Alesha Argeras, who ended up going 4-for-4 on the day. Freshman pitcher Courtney Fitzgerald took the loss for St. John's to fall to 7-11.
In game two, Notre Dame got a complete-game shutout from sophomore pitcher Michelle Moschel, who gave up just three hits. The Irish scored one in the first, one in the fifth and three in the seventh, for their five runs. Sophomore Tiffany Howerton led St. John's, recording two of the three hits.
